re PR tree-optimization/32383 (ICE with reciprocals and -ffast-math)

PR tree-optimization/32383
	* targhooks.c (default_builtin_reciprocal): Add new bool argument.
	* targhooks.h (default_builtin_reciprocal): Update prototype.
	* target.h (struct gcc_target): Update builtin_reciprocal.
	* doc/tm.texi (TARGET_BUILTIN_RECIPROCAL): Update description.
	* tree-ssa-math-opts (execute_cse_reciprocals): Skip statements
	where arg1 is not SSA_NAME.  Pass true to targetm.builtin_reciprocal
	when fndecl is in BUILT_IN_MD class.
	(execute_convert_to_rsqrt): Ditto.

	* config/i386/i386.c (ix86_builtin_reciprocal): Update for new bool
	argument.  Convert IX86_BUILTIN_SQRTPS code only when md_fn is true.
	Convert BUILT_IN_SQRTF code only  when md_fn is false.

testsuite/ChangeLog:

	PR tree-optimization/32383
	* testsuite/g++.dg/opt/pr32383.C: New test.

From-SVN: r125790

@deftypefn {Target Hook} tree TARGET_BUILTIN_RECIPROCAL (enum tree_code @var{code}, bool @var{sqrt})
@deftypefn {Target Hook} tree TARGET_BUILTIN_RECIPROCAL (enum tree_code @var{fn}, bool @var{tm_fn}, bool @var{sqrt})
This hook should return the DECL of a function that implements reciprocal of
the builtin function with builtin function code @var{code}, or
@code{NULL_TREE} if such a function is not available. When @var{sqrt} is
true, additional optimizations that apply only to the reciprocal of a square
root function are performed, and only reciprocals of @code{sqrt} function
are valid.
the builtin function with builtin function code @var{fn}, or
@code{NULL_TREE} if such a function is not available. @var{tm_fn} is true
when @var{fn} is a code of a machine-dependent builtin function. When
@var{sqrt} is true, additional optimizations that apply only to the reciprocal
of a square root function are performed, and only reciprocals of @code{sqrt}
function are valid.
@end deftypefn
